On January 16th, after a couple days of having a fever, my sister, Lolly, started to see a couple red blisters on her nose. In a matter of hours, she was at her doctors' office being told to go immediately to the emergency room as the redness had worked its way up her nose and was starting to cause her right eye to swell.

What happened in the next couple hours was frightening as we got her to Cedars Sinai Hospital and a bed-side surgery was being performed in her hospital room within 24 hours.

She had contracted both the flu virus and strep that made its way into her blood stream and started forming an ocular abscess. She was later told that if she had waited 24 hours longer, she would most likely have died.

For any normal immune system, this would be hard to fight off, but Lolly has been dealing with Crohn's disease over the last 10 years, and takes an infusion that causes her immune system to be compromised as it is.

After the first two initial weeks in the hospital and a few days at home, a second abscess was discovered and Lolly had to rush in for an emergency surgery.

She is recovering at home now. Her eye is bandaged and healing, but the doctors say they cannot perform another corrective surgery, if needed, for a year.



Lolly is a single mom and has a 17 year old son. It goes without saying that this has been very difficult for him to deal with. She has been relying on friends and family to get her son back and forth to school, take her to her many doctors' appointments, collect groceries and pick up prescriptions.
